How Does Silk·expert Pro3 Work?

Silk·expert Pro3 is designed to help break the cycle of hair growth. Light energy is transferred through the skin's surface and is absorbed by melanin present in the hair shaft. The absorbed light energy is converted to heat energy (below the surface of the skin), which disables the hair follicle. Treated hairs naturally fall out over the course of a few days to 1-2 weeks.

What to Expect
Immediately post treatment, you should not see any significant side effects from treatment (Refer to "Potential Risks, Side Effects and Skin Reactions" section for more information on side effects).
In the first few weeks following the initial treatments, you will still see some hairs growing. These are likely to be hairs that were missed during treatment i.e. they were lying dormant and not in their growth phase (Anagen) during treatment, when IPL is most effective.
Around 6 weeks into the 12 week treatment program you should see a reduction in hair growth. However, many hairs may still not have been treated in their growth phase. It is important to continue the weekly treatments.
After the 12 week program, you should see a significant reduction in hairs within the treated area. Any remaining hairs should be finer and lighter in color. Continued monthly treatments, or treatments as required, should maintain the reduction in unwanted hair.

Important Safety Information

Contraindications

DO NOT use the device if you have very dark skin. The Skin Tone sensors located near the output window of the device will determine the tone of your skin. If the Skin Tone sensors determine your skin is too dark for safe use, operation will be prevented.
DO NOT use the device if your skin has been artificially or naturally tanned recently or is burned from sun overexposure. Your skin may be extra sensitive following sun exposure and particularly susceptible to burning, blistering, discoloring or scarring if you use the device. Wait 1 week until sunburn or tan disappears before using the device. Treating tanned skin with IPL may result in permanent Hyper (darkening) or Hypo (lightening) changes to the treated skin.
DO NOT expose treated areas to the sun. Wait at least 7 days after treatment before exposing treated skin to direct sunlight. Your skin may be extra sensitive following IPL treatment and particularly susceptible to sunburn. Apply sunscreen (SPF 15 or greater) to the treated area or cover the treated area with suitable clothing.
DO NOT use the device directly on the nipples, genitals or around the anus. These areas may have a darker skin color and/or greater hair density. Using the device in these areas may cause discomfort/pain or injure (burn, discolor or scar) your skin.
DO NOT use the device if you have a history of skin cancer or pre-cancerous lesions (e.g. nevi or a large number of moles).
DO NOT use if you are pregnant, lactating, as this device has not been tested with these individuals.
DO NOT use on dark brown or black spots such as birthmarks, moles or warts in the area you wish to treat. Using the device may injure your skin or make existing conditions worse. You may experience side effects such as burns, blisters and skin color changes or scarring.
DO NOT use if you have any skin condition in the treatment area, including psoriasis, vitiligo, eczema, acne, herpes simplex or active infections, wounds or blisters.
DO NOT use if you are under the age of 18 as this device has not been tested on these individuals.
DO NOT use on scars, tattoos or permanent make up in the treatment area.
DO NOT use on beard/facial hair for men.

Warnings

DO NOT use if you have a known sensitivity to sunlight (photosensitivity) or are taking a medication that causes photosensitivity e.g., certain antibiotics such as tetracycline, NSAIDS such as ibuprofen or retinoids such as Accutane and/or topical retinoids such as Retin A. Always check the instructions that come with your medical products to see if photosensitivity is listed as a side effect. Using the Silk Expert device on photosensitive skin could result in skin damage including blisters and swelling.
DO NOT use more than once a week on the same area. Damage of skin may occur after prolonged or repeated treatment on one site.
It is not recommended to use this device where dermal fillers are present.

Women who are using the device on the face:
DO NOT use if you have had a skin peel treatment on the area of the face you wish to treat. You should wait 30 days after a skin peel before treating.
DO NOT use if you have had a laser skin resurfacing procedure on the area of the face you wish to treat. You should wait 6 months following a laser skin resurfacing procedure before treating.

EYE SAFETY
The device emits flashes of Intense Pulsed Light. Direct exposure is potentially harmful to your eyes. Take care to follow the safety precautions below.
Possible eye injury (potentially leading to loss of vision) or skin injury if instructions are not followed. Protect the eye from exposure. Do not use the device over the eye lids or close to the eye.
The device can only be activated (flashed) if both Skin Tone Sensors (2) detect a valid Skin Tone reading. However:
DO NOT look directly into the treatment window (1) when the device has electrical power and is activated.
DO NOT attempt to activate (flash) the device towards the eye.
DO NOT treat areas around the eye (eyebrows or eyelashes).
ONLY attempt to activate (flash) the device when the treatment window is in good contact with the area you wish to treat.
WE RECOMMEND you look away from the device when pushing the treatment button.

Precautions

Hair removal by lasers or intense pulse light sources can cause increased hair growth in some individuals. Based upon currently available data, the highest risk groups for this response are females of Mediterranean, Middle Eastern, and South Asian heritage treated on the face and neck.
DO NOT USE the device on any area where you may want hair to grow back.
The device is not recommended for use on red, grey, white or blonde hair since it is not effective on these hair colors.

Potential Risks, Side Effects and Skin Reactions

The use of this device could result in side effects. The table below lists the known skin reactions that may occur following treatment with the device.

Possible Side Effects How to assess and react
Mild pain / discomfort in the area being treated This is expected and is normal for all IPL treatments. You can keep on using the device as instructed, and the pain should diminish with continued use.
Warm feeling or tingling sensations during treatment, which typically disappear after a few seconds to a minute and decrease with continued use. This is expected and is normal for all IPL treatments. You can keep on using the device as instructed.
Itchiness in the treatment area This is quite common for IPL treatments, and should subside after a short period. You can keep on using the device as instructed. Do not scratch the area.
Skin redness during or after treatment which disappears within minutes. This is expected and is normal for all IPL treatments. You can keep on using the device as instructed once skin redness has disappeared.
Skin redness which does not disappear within minutes and lasts 24-48 hours. Stop using the device immediately and consult your physician before using it again.
Pain or discomfort that is intense during treatment or persists after a treatment. Stop using the device immediately and consult your physician before using it again.
In very rare cases How to assess and react
Swelling and redness that does not disappear within two to three days. Stop using the device immediately and consult your physician before using it again.
Temporary changes in skin color (lightening or darkening). If your skin color changes, stop using the device immediately and consult your physician.
Blistering or burning of the skin. Stop using the device immediately and consult your physician before using it again. Apply a cold pack to the area. Treat with antiseptic or burn cream.

In a clinical trial of 50 subjects, each subject received 12 weekly treatments. The recorded effects were:

  • Itchiness: Four subjects experienced mild itchiness after treatment.
  • Slight Redness: This was reported by 1 subject.
  • Mild Stinging Sensation: Five subjects reported mild discomfort following treatment.
  • In-growing Hair: One subject reported experiencing an in-growing hair following treatment.
  • Follicle Redness: One subject reported a red spot at the treatment site following treatment.

In all cases, the treated skin returned to normal within 7 days.

Benefits

The device is indicated for the permanent reduction of unwanted hair.
A clinical trial was performed to assess both the safety and efficacy of the device. The key features of the clinical trial were:

  • All treatments were performed by non-medically trained operators at a single location using devices identical to the one provided in this package;
  • All subjects were required to complete questionnaires related to their general health and those who could not be treated, e.g. those who had one or more of the contraindications as listed in "Important Safety Information" Section of this User Manual were excluded. In addition, all subjects were required to provide Informed Consent as per international clinical trial requirements;
  • A total of 53 female subjects, aged between 19 and 45 years old, commenced the trial;
  • Three subjects left the trial during the treatment period for personal reasons. No subjects left the trial due to problems associated with the use of the device;
  • Each subject received 12 weekly treatments to their chosen body location. A typical treatment consisted of shaving the site then applying the device following the same process as outlined in "How to Use" Section, Step 3 of this user manual;
  • Hair counts were used to measure the change in the amount of hair 6 months after the last treatment and 12 months after the last treatment. The hairs in the treatment sites were counted via high resolution photography and the difference in hair counts was calculated as a percentage change;
  • When used as directed, the clinical trial participants showed on average 44% less hair 6 months after their last treatment and 36% less hair 12 months after their last treatment when compared to hair counts taken before treatment (see table below). Actual results did vary from person to person.
Number of subjects at 6 months post treatment 50
Hair reduction at 6 months post treatment 43.9%
Number of subjects at 12 months post treatment 33
Hair reduction at 12 months post treatment 36.0%
% of subjects met success (> 30% hair reduction) on all body areas at 12 months post treatment. Subject success is defined as greater than 30% hair reduction at all treatment sites at 12 months. 66.7%
  • The incidence of side effects during the clinical trial was minimal (as outlined in "Potential Risks, Side Effects and Skin Reactions" Section above) and the majority of subjects (48 out of 50) would recommend the device to their friends.

Intended Use

USE
The device is intended for the permanent reduction in unwanted, visible hair for a single user.

BODY AREAS
Women: Legs, arms, underarms, bikini area and face (below the cheek bones)

Do not use the device near the eyes, along the forehead, on the lips or nostrils. Do not use it in the genital area.
Men: Shoulders and below (chest, back, arms, stomach, legs)

Do not use on the face, neck or genital area.
The device is intended to be used on body hair below the neck, including arms, underarms, bikini line, stomach and legs.

SKIN COLOR
The device is intended for use on light, medium and dark skin tones up to and including skin tone V (see Skin tone chart). The device incorporates two Skin Tone Sensors that measure the color of your skin and will prevent use if your skin tone is too dark.

HAIR COLOR
The device is intended for use on naturally black or brown hair. It may not be as effective on white, grey, blonde or red hair.

How To Use


Follow each step in the treatment process ensuring you complete all aspects of each step before progressing to the next.

  1. Preparing the treatment area
    Remove all visible hair on the skin before using the device. You may use your preferred hair removal method. Remove any cosmetics, lotions and cream from the area you wish to treat. Cleanse the treatment area and pat dry. To keep the treatment window clean and intact and prevent hair burns, make sure there is no more hair remaining on the skin surface.
  2. Doing a Test Patch
    Before your first treatment on each new body area, we RECOMMEND you test your skin (in that area) for reactions.
    The patch test area should be approximately 3 cm x 2 cm in size (equivalent to 2 flashes applied to the skin side by side). Follow Step 3 to treat the area.
    Wait 24 hours following the patch test, to ensure your skin is suitable for treatment and there is no adverse reaction to the light energy. If there is no reaction after 24 hours, you may treat the area around the test patch. The 'patch tested area' should not be re-treated for at least one week.
  3. Treating with Silk·expert Pro
    1. Use the mains cord (8) to connect the base station to an electrical outlet. Press any button to activate the device. The LED power bars (3) will light up once and a fan will start running. This means the device is in READY mode. During operation, the device will heat up slightly.
    2. Press the treatment window (1) firmly against the area to be treated ensuring both skin tone sensors (2) are in contact with skin. The device will not operate if only one skin tone sensor is in contact with skin. Once both skin tone sensors measure a valid skin tone, the pre-set output power is displayed on the LED Power Bars (3) located on both sides of the device.

Silk·expert Pro uses skin tone sensors that continuously measure the color (tone) of your skin and automatically set the correct level of output power needed based on the measured skin tone. This is not related to the Fitzpatrick skin tone classification. If your skin is too dark for treatment with Silk·expert Pro, the skin tone sensors will detect this and prevent the unit from operating.
RED lights will be shown in the Power Bar if your skin is too dark.
If a valid skin tone is detected, the Power Bars will illuminate WHITE.

  1. Your Treatment Schedule
    For optimal results, Silk·expert should be used once a week for 12 weeks to ensure all hair follicles are treated. After the initial treatment phase (12 treatments), we recommend the device is used once a month, or as required, to maintain results.
  2. Switching Off the Device
    When the treatment is finished, unplug the device. Refer to "Cleaning, Maintenance and Storage" section for details of how best to look after your device.

Cleaning, Maintenance and Storage

After treatment, always unplug the device.
After use, the handset, the skin tone sensors (2) and the treatment window (1) should be inspected for damage and wiped down with a dry, lint free cloth. If any marks or black spots are seen, then it is best to clean them off straight away after treatment.
NEVER use water or other cleaning fluids, as these can damage the device leading to a potential safety hazard.

The glass filter (9) can get hot during use. DO NOT touch or clean the filter for at least 5 minutes after use to allow it to cool down.
To ensure maximum performance, keep the heads (10, 11, 12) with their built-in reflectors free from dirt, hair or other debris. Do not clean them in water, but use a dry cloth for cleaning them carefully.
Store the device in a cool, dry place. Make sure that the treatment window and skin tone sensors are protected from damage.
Regularly check the device (including cords) for visible signs of damage. In case of damage or cracks, stop using the device.

Technical specifications

Braun Silk·expert Pro3 is a filtered broadband Intense Pulsed Light system with the following technical specifications:

Repetition rate: every 0.6 - 0.67 seconds (depending on treatment setting), continuous operation
Max optical output: 4.21 J/cm2
Pulse length 2.6 msec FWHM
Wave length: 510 - 2000 nm
Power line input: 100 - 240V~, 50-60Hz, 1.7 - 0.91A
Operating temperature: 5°C - 40°C / 41°F - 104°F
Optimum operating temperature: 15°C - 30°C / 59°F - 86°F
Operating humidity: up to 93% R.H. non-condensing
Operating pressures: 700 hPa to 1060 hPa
Treatment area (spot size): 3 cm² (Wide head: 4 cm², Precision head: 1.5 cm²)

Transport Conditions:

Temperature range: – 25°C to 70°C / –13°F to 158°F
Humidity: up to 93% R.H. non-condensing
Pressures: 500 hPa to 1060 hPa

The device includes 300,000 flashes and is intended for a single user. Expected service life: 5 years
